Kwara United to relocate to Lagos for CAF Confederations Cup

The Afonja Warriors certified for CAF’s second-tier competitors by way of the backdoor, however they won’t be able to play their video games on house soil
Nigeria Skilled Soccer League aspect Kwara United will undertake the Mobolaji Johnson Stadium in Lagos for all their house video games within the upcoming CAF Confederations Cup.
Kwara United had been handed the 2022/23 Confederations Cup ticket because of the NFF’s incapability to satisfy CAF’s deadline for the submission of continental representatives.
Previously, the winners of the Nigerian FA Cup bought an automated slot within the Confederations Cup preliminaries. Nevertheless, because the Afonja Warriors end 4th on the NPFL desk, they bought the nod to characterize Nigeria on the continent.
Nonetheless, based on reports from NPFL News, Kwara United are set to undertake the Mobolaji Johnson Stadium in Lagos as their house floor for the 2022/2023 CAF Confederations Cup.
The explanation for the membership’s resolution is that the Ilorin Township Stadium doesn’t meet CAF’s requirements. Actually, solely six stadiums in Nigeria meet the continent’s football-running physique’s requirements.
The Godswill Akpabio Stadium, Uyo; Samuel Ogbemudia Stadium, Edo State; Enyimba Worldwide Stadium, Aba; Stephen Keshi Memorial Stadium, in Delta State; and the MKO Abiola Nationwide Stadium, Abuja; and the Mobolaji Johnson stadium in Lagos.
The Afonja Warriors must make do with the 26,000-capacity Mobolaji Johnson Stadium in Lagos.
Kwara United play their first fixture in opposition to AS Douanes on the ninth of September. Then they journey for the second leg which takes place in Senegal 9 days later.
